3. Diverse Properties of Aromatic Plant Extracts

3.1. Antimicrobial Properties

One of the most significant properties of aromatic plant extracts is their antimicrobial activity. These extracts contain various compounds such as phenols, terpenes, and flavonoids that can inhibit the growth of pathogenic microorganisms. For example, carvacrol and thymol, which are present in oregano and thyme extracts respectively, have been shown to be effective against bacteria like Escherichia coli and Salmonella. This antimicrobial property can play a vital role in ruminant diets as it can help to reduce the presence of harmful bacteria in the rumen, which in turn can improve the overall health of the ruminants.

3.2. Antioxidant Properties

Aromatic plant extracts are also rich in antioxidants. Antioxidants are substances that can prevent or slow down oxidative damage to cells. In ruminants, oxidative stress can occur due to various factors such as high - fat diets or environmental stressors. The antioxidants in the plant extracts, such as flavonoids and phenolic acids, can scavenge free radicals and protect the cells of the ruminant's body from oxidative damage. This can lead to improved immune function, better reproductive performance, and enhanced overall health.

4. Influence on Ruminant Health

4.1. Rumen Function

The addition of aromatic plant extracts to ruminant diets can have a positive impact on rumen function. They can help to regulate the microbial population in the rumen. For example, by inhibiting the growth of harmful bacteria, they can create a more favorable environment for beneficial bacteria such as those involved in fiber digestion. This can lead to improved digestion and absorption of nutrients from the feed, which is essential for the growth and development of ruminants.

6. Contribution to the Overall Sustainability of Ruminant Farming

6.1. Reducing Antibiotic Use

The antimicrobial properties of aromatic plant extracts can help to reduce the need for antibiotics in ruminant farming. Excessive use of antibiotics in animal farming has led to concerns about antibiotic resistance. By using plant extracts as a natural alternative to control harmful bacteria, farmers can contribute to the global effort to combat antibiotic resistance and promote more sustainable farming practices.

6.2. Improving Feed Efficiency

As the extracts can enhance nutrient digestion and absorption, they can improve feed efficiency. This means that ruminants can obtain more nutrients from a given amount of feed. This can lead to a reduction in the amount of feed required, which is not only cost - effective for farmers but also has environmental benefits. Less feed production means less land use, water consumption, and greenhouse gas emissions associated with feed production.
